Output 6155150299824eb9903d0e6136c5fd886177b96098a053125a48cfd3c709a401:151

value
135569
script pubkey
OP_0 OP_PUSHBYTES_32 3940f4bfd7af8ed8738fae3fb0cf674df6536e44cf879da24ce0b90d4198ff4e
address
bc1q89q0f07h478dsuu04clmpnm8fhm9xmjye7remgjvuzus6svcla8qr4lruj
transaction
6155150299824eb9903d0e6136c5fd886177b96098a053125a48cfd3c709a401